The Icefields Parkway is one of the most scenic drives in the world, attracting travelers with its breathtaking views of mountains, glaciers, and pristine lakes. However, while the journey can be rewarding, it's crucial to be aware of safety tips to ensure a pleasant experience. Here are essential safety tips for traveling the Icefields Parkway.
1. Check Weather Conditions
Weather in the mountainous regions can change rapidly. Before setting out, check the forecast for the day and be prepared for sudden drops in temperature, rain, or even snow, depending on the season. Always carry appropriate clothing and gear to stay comfortable.
2. Plan Your Route
Familiarize yourself with the Icefields Parkway route and highlight key stops, including popular attractions like the Columbia Icefield and Peyto Lake. On a map or navigation app, note any gas stations, rest stops, and visitor centers, as they can be few and far between.
3. Fuel Up
Gas stations along the Icefields Parkway can be sparse, so fill up your tank before starting your journey. Having a full tank ensures you can explore comfortably without worrying about finding fuel. It's a good idea to fill up whenever you have the opportunity.
4. Wildlife Awareness
This area is rich in wildlife, including bears, elk, and moose. Always drive slowly and be vigilant, especially near wildlife crossings. In the event of an animal sighting, stop your vehicle at a safe distance and avoid approaching the animal.
5. Follow Road Safety Regulations
Adhere to the speed limits and other road signs. The stunning scenery can be distracting, but safety should always come first. Be especially cautious during rainy or snowy conditions, as roads can become slippery.
6. Stay Hydrated and Nourished
Pack plenty of water and snacks to keep you energized throughout the drive. There are few facilities along the parkway, so having your own supplies helps maintain energy levels and prevents dehydration.
7. Mobile Connectivity
In many areas of the Icefields Parkway, mobile reception can be unreliable or non-existent. Inform someone of your travel plans and estimated return time. Consider bringing a map or a GPS device that doesn't rely solely on mobile data.
8. Emergency Preparedness
Always be prepared for emergencies. Carry a first aid kit, spare tire, jumper cables, and basic tools. Make sure your vehicle is in good condition before you start your journey, checking the brakes, tires, and fluid levels.
9. Respect Nature
As you enjoy the natural beauty, remember to practice Leave No Trace principles. Stay on designated paths, dispose of waste responsibly, and avoid disturbing wildlife and plants. Respecting the environment ensures that future visitors can also enjoy this stunning landscape.
10. Enjoy Responsibly
Finally, take your time to soak in the views and appreciate the surroundings. Stop at designated overlooks to take photos and enjoy the scenery, but always park in safe areas to avoid accidents.
